What Are Dental Implants?
A dental implant is a small, biocompatible titanium post that is carefully placed into the jawbone to replace the root of a missing tooth. Once the implant integrates with the surrounding bone through a natural healing process known as osseointegration, it serves as a stable foundation for a custom-made dental crown, bridge, or denture.
Unlike removable tooth replacement options, dental implants are designed to feel, function, and look like natural teeth. They can help restore chewing efficiency, improve speech, support facial structure, and prevent the bone loss that often occurs after a tooth is lost.
Depending on your individual needs, implants may be used to replace:
- A single missing tooth
- Multiple missing teeth
- Several teeth with an implant-supported bridge
- An entire arch with implant-supported prostheses
The most appropriate treatment option will always depend on a detailed clinical evaluation and treatment plan.
Are You a Suitable Candidate for Dental Implants?
Many adults with missing teeth may be candidates for implant treatment, but suitability depends on several factors rather than age alone. Your dentist will evaluate:
Bone Quality and Quantity
Healthy jawbone is essential to support a dental implant. If bone loss has occurred, additional procedures such as bone grafting may sometimes be recommended before implant placement.
Healthy Gums
Healthy gums provide a strong foundation for successful implant treatment. Existing gum disease, if present, is usually treated before implants are placed.
General Health
Medical conditions such as uncontrolled diabetes, smoking habits, certain medications, or other systemic health concerns may influence treatment planning and healing. Your dentist will review your medical history carefully to recommend the most appropriate approach.
Oral Hygiene
Long-term implant success depends on maintaining good oral hygiene and attending regular dental check-ups after treatment.

Why Is a CBCT Scan Important Before Dental Implants?
One of the most important steps in successful implant treatment is accurate diagnosis.
A Cone Beam Computed Tomography (CBCT) scan provides a detailed three-dimensional view of your teeth, jawbone, nerves, and surrounding structures—information that cannot always be obtained from a standard dental X-ray alone.
CBCT imaging helps your dentist evaluate:
- Bone height and width
- Bone density
- The exact location of nerves
- Sinus anatomy in the upper jaw
- Available space for implant placement
- Existing infections or hidden concerns
- Overall suitability for implant treatment
This level of detail allows implants to be planned with greater precision, improving both safety and predictability.
